- SCITECHEOct 03, 2020 · 6 years agoSure! One of the easiest ways to mine bitcoin is by joining a mining pool. Mining pools are groups of miners who work together to mine bitcoin and share the rewards. By joining a mining pool, you can combine your computing power with others and increase your chances of earning bitcoin. Some popular mining pools include Slush Pool, F2Pool, and Antpool. Another easy way to mine bitcoin is by using cloud mining services. Cloud mining allows you to rent mining equipment from a provider and mine bitcoin remotely. This eliminates the need for expensive hardware and technical knowledge. Some reputable cloud mining providers include Genesis Mining and Hashflare. Lastly, you can also mine bitcoin by purchasing specialized mining hardware called ASICs (Application-Specific Integrated Circuits). ASICs are designed specifically for mining bitcoin and offer high hash rates, increasing your chances of mining bitcoin successfully. However, ASICs can be quite expensive and may require additional setup and maintenance. It's important to do your research and consider the cost and potential returns before investing in mining hardware.
- abdul rehmanNov 02, 2021 · 4 years agoWell, mining bitcoin can be a bit complex, but there are definitely some easier ways to get started. One option is to mine bitcoin using your computer's CPU or GPU. This method is less efficient compared to using specialized mining hardware, but it can still be a good way to learn about the mining process. You can use software like CGMiner or EasyMiner to mine bitcoin using your computer. Another easy way to mine bitcoin is by using a mining app on your smartphone. There are several mining apps available for both Android and iOS devices that allow you to mine bitcoin using your phone's processing power. However, keep in mind that mining with your phone may not be very profitable due to the limited computing power. Additionally, you can also consider mining alternative cryptocurrencies and exchanging them for bitcoin. Some cryptocurrencies, like Litecoin or Ethereum, can be mined using less powerful hardware and then converted to bitcoin. This can be a more cost-effective way to mine bitcoin, especially if you already have the necessary hardware for mining other cryptocurrencies.
